Vehicle floor mats are an essential component of any car, truck or SUV, as they help to protect the vehicle's interior from dirt, debris, and other contaminants. However, over time, floor mats can become worn, stained, or damaged, which can lead to the need for replacement. There are a number of reasons why people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often than others.

One of the main reasons why people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often is due to heavy use. If a vehicle is used frequently and for long distances, the floor mats may become worn down more quickly. This can be especially true for those who frequently transport heavy cargo or have pets that travel with them in the car.

Another reason why people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often is due to the weather. Floor mats that are exposed to extreme temperatures, heavy rain or snow may become worn down more quickly. This is because the mats absorb moisture and can become moldy or mildewed, which can make them unsanitary and unappealing.

Another reason why people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often is due to poor maintenance. Not cleaning the mats properly, not vacuuming them frequently, not removing spills or stains in a timely manner can lead to the mats becoming unsanitary and unappealing.

Another reason is that people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often is due to the type of mats they are using. Some mats are made of lower quality materials and may not be as durable as others. This means that they may wear out more quickly and need to be replaced more often.

Overall, there are a variety of reasons why people may have to change their vehicle floor mats more often. Heavy use, weather, poor maintenance, and the type of mats used can all contribute to the need for replacement.
